Microscopic axonal tearing from shearing forces in severe head trauma
Expansion
Diffuse Axonal Injury
Purpose
Associated with prolonged coma; multiple microhaemorrhages on gradient echo magnetic resonance imaging
Clinical Context
Diffuse axonal injury common in severe traumatic brain injury with altered consciousness. Gradient-recalled echo or susceptibility-weighted imaging shows microhaemorrhages at grey-white junction, brainstem, corpus callosum. Poor prognosis.
